Defense, Safety, and Regulatory Battles Surrounding AI as Critical Infrastructure

As AI technology increasingly becomes woven into the fabric of national security and critical infrastructure, the landscape of defense, safety, and regulation is rapidly evolving into a complex battleground. Governments, enterprises, and tech providers are navigating a web of geopolitical tensions, legal flashpoints, and safety concerns that threaten to reshape the future of AI deployment in sensitive sectors.

The Pro-Human Roadmap and Defense Tech Reckoning

At the core of the current debates is the push for trustworthy AI—systems designed with human safety, transparency, and ethical standards at the forefront. Organizations like Anthropic have positioned themselves as advocates for safe and aligned AI development, emphasizing the importance of content provenance, behavior telemetry, and regulatory compliance. However, recent developments highlight the tension between innovation and security.

The Pentagon’s designation of Anthropic as a supply-chain risk underscores these concerns. Multiple articles, including reports from TechCrunch and official statements, reveal that the Defense Department officially informed Anthropic that its products pose risks to supply-chain security, especially considering potential misuse or vulnerabilities in autonomous warfare capabilities. Notably, Anthropic’s AI models, such as Claude, have been flagged for use in sensitive contexts, including reports of their deployment in Iran, triggering bans and restrictions. This reckoning with defense-related vulnerabilities demonstrates the heightened scrutiny AI providers face when their systems intersect with national security interests.

Further, the Pentagon’s actions have sparked legal and strategic conflicts, with Anthropic filing lawsuits challenging the government’s designation, arguing that such restrictions could hinder innovation and the development of safe AI. Analogously, other military and security agencies are reevaluating their relationships with AI vendors, emphasizing risk management and content security as paramount.

Broader US/EU Regulatory Debates and AI’s Role in Security Markets

Beyond individual companies, regulatory frameworks are shaping the global AI landscape. The EU AI Act has set a comprehensive standard emphasizing trustworthy AI principles, risk management, and content provenance, compelling organizations operating within Europe to embed Governance-as-Code and continuous observability into their AI systems. These measures aim to ensure compliance and mitigate risks associated with misinformation, fabricated citations, and malicious use.

In the United States, regulatory efforts are increasingly focused on critical infrastructure and defense applications. Agencies are adopting stricter vendor vetting, audit trails, and content authenticity verification mechanisms. For example, tools like Traceloop, acquired by ServiceNow, are being deployed to enable real-time behavior telemetry and content traceability, vital for legal compliance and trustworthiness.

These regulatory developments are also driving geopolitical shifts. The designation of companies like Anthropic as supply-chain risks reflects broader efforts to localize AI infrastructure and develop sovereign AI platforms. Enterprises are investing heavily in regional data centers and domestic AI ecosystems—such as Pine Labs’ 1-gigawatt data center and Nvidia’s $2 billion Nscale platform—to reduce dependency on foreign vendors and enhance security resilience. While such measures bolster regional sovereignty, they also fragment the global AI ecosystem, complicating interoperability and cross-border collaboration.
